PUMCH Co-op Projects Win 2018 National Sci-tech Award

On January 8, 2019, the 2018 National Science and Technology Progress Award were unveiled at the Great Hall of the People. “Key technology, system and clinical application of DBS”, a cooperation between Neurosurgery, PUMCH, Tsinghua University and other institutions won the first prize, PUMCH being the third winning organization. “Key technology and application of pen-based human-computer interaction” a cooperation between Neurology, PUMCH and Institute of Software, Chinese Academy of Sciences and other institutions won the second prize, PUMCH being the fourth winning organization.

The DBS project, combining medical with engineering, is self-developed core technology that tackled a world clinical difficulty and started China’s DBS from scratch. Through innovations in design, technique, clinical plan and application paradigm, the DBS comprehensive technological system led the development of neuromodulation techniques. Associate Professor Guo Yi from our Neurosurgery participated for more than ten years in the clinical development and application of the project, by proposing and helping develop new type electrode fixers and improving DBS in clinical application.  

The pen-based human-computer interaction project solved a series of difficulties including continuous recognition of hand-written Chinese characters, and realized interaction with hand written texts and graphs. It can be widely applied in education, sports and medical care. Professor Cui Liying and Professor Zhu Yicheng from our Neurology led the research in clinical diagnosis and nerve function assessment. They smartly designed the interaction process as a data collection tool for fine movement of upper limbs, and realized nerve function assessment in non-interference state. It has been applied in clinical research and provided technological support for nerve function monitoring based on daily life in future.
